Decision details

Extension of existing contract for Touchstone consortium's Healthwatch Leeds, Contract reference number: LCCW25311, for 1 x 12 month period under Contract Procedure Rule 21.1

Reference: D43819

Decision Maker: Director of Adult Social Services

Is Key decision?: Yes

Is subject to call in?: Yes

Purpose:

The Director of Adult Social Services approved the recommendation of the 1 x 12 month extension of the current contract with the Touchstone consortium for Healthwatch Leeds (reference LCCW225311).  This extension will commence 1st April 2017 and run until 31st March 2018.  The annual contract value is £374,400 and provisions are available to cover this within the Adult Social Care budget.

The Commissioning Officer will liaise with the Programmes, Projects and Procurement Unit (PPPU) to oversee the implementation of the extension of the existing arrangements before they expire on 31st March 2017.
